1. Imiqondo eyisisekelo yokucima uchungechunge lwe-roller
Ukucima kuyinqubo yokwelapha ukushisa efudumeza uchungechunge lwe-roller ezingeni lokushisa elithile, ilugcine lufudumele isikhathi esithile, bese luphola ngokushesha. Inhloso yalo ukuthuthukisa izakhiwo zemishini zochungechunge lwe-roller, njengokuqina namandla, ngokushintsha isakhiwo se-metallographic sezinto. Ukupholisa okusheshayo kuguqula i-austenite ibe yi-martensite noma i-bainite, okunikeza uchungechunge lwe-roller izakhiwo ezinhle kakhulu eziphelele.
2. Isisekelo sokunquma izinga lokushisa lokucima
Iphuzu elibalulekile lezinto zokwakha: Amaketanga e-roller ezinto ezahlukene anamaphuzu ahlukile abalulekile, njenge-Ac1 ne-Ac3. I-Ac1 izinga lokushisa eliphakeme kakhulu lesifunda se-pearlite ne-ferrite esinezigaba ezimbili, kanti i-Ac3 izinga lokushisa eliphansi kakhulu lokwenziwa kwe-austenitization ephelele. Izinga lokushisa lokucima livame ukukhethwa ngaphezu kwe-Ac3 noma i-Ac1 ukuqinisekisa ukuthi izinto zifakwe i-austenit ngokugcwele. Isibonelo, kumaketanga e-roller enziwe ngensimbi engu-45, i-Ac1 icishe ibe ngu-727℃, i-Ac3 icishe ibe ngu-780℃, kanti izinga lokushisa lokucima livame ukukhethwa cishe ku-800℃.
Izidingo zokwakheka kwezinto kanye nokusebenza kwazo: Okuqukethwe kwezinto ezixubayo kuthinta ukuqina nokusebenza kwamaketanga okugoqa. Kumaketanga okugoqayo anokuqukethwe okuphezulu kwezinto ezixubayo, njengezintambo ezixubayo zensimbi ezixubayo, izinga lokushisa lokucima lingakhushulwa ngokufanele ukuze kwandiswe ukuqina nokuqinisekisa ukuthi umongo ungaphinde uthole ubulukhuni namandla amahle. Kumaketanga okugoqayo ensimbi angenakhabhoni ephansi, izinga lokushisa lokucima alikwazi ukuba phezulu kakhulu ukuze kugwenywe ukungcoliswa okukhulu kanye nokungaguquki kwekhabhoni, okuthinta ikhwalithi yobuso.
Ukulawulwa kosayizi wezinhlamvu ze-Austenite: izinhlamvu ze-austenite ezincane zingathola isakhiwo esihle se-martensite ngemva kokucima, ukuze i-roller chain ibe namandla aphezulu nokuqina. Ngakho-ke, izinga lokushisa lokucima kufanele likhethwe ngaphakathi kobubanzi obungathola izinhlamvu ze-austenite ezincane. Ngokuvamile, njengoba izinga lokushisa likhuphuka, izinhlamvu ze-austenite zivame ukukhula, kodwa ukwandisa izinga lokupholisa noma ukwamukela izinyathelo zenqubo yokuhlanza izinhlamvu kungavimbela ukukhula kwezinhlamvu ngezinga elithile.
3. Izici ezinquma isikhathi sokucima
Usayizi kanye nesimo seketanga lama-roller: amaketanga ama-roller amakhulu adinga isikhathi eside sokushisa ukuqinisekisa ukuthi ukushisa kudluliselwe ngokuphelele ngaphakathi futhi yonke ingxenye yesiphambano iqiniswa ngokulinganayo. Isibonelo, kuma-roller chain plates anobubanzi obukhulu, isikhathi sokushisa singandiswa ngokufanele.
Indlela yokulayisha nokufaka isithando somlilo: Ukufaka isithando somlilo esiningi kakhulu noma ukufaka isithando somlilo esiminyene kakhulu kuzobangela ukushisa okungalingani kweketanga lama-roller, okuholela ekungalinganini kokuzinza. Ngakho-ke, lapho kunqunywa isikhathi sokucima, kubalulekile ukucabangela umthelela wokufaka isithando somlilo nendlela yokufaka isithando somlilo ekudlulisweni kokushisa, ukwandisa isikhathi sokubamba ngokufanele, nokuqinisekisa ukuthi iketanga ngalinye lama-roller lingafinyelela umphumela ofanele wokucima.
Ukufana kwezinga lokushisa lesithando kanye nezinga lokushisa: Imishini yokushisa enokulingana okuhle kwezinga lokushisa lesithando ingenza zonke izingxenye zeketanga le-roller zifudumale ngokulinganayo, futhi isikhathi esidingekayo ukuze kufinyelelwe izinga lokushisa elifanayo sifushane, futhi isikhathi sokubamba singancishiswa ngokufanele. Izinga lokushisa lizothinta nezinga le-austenitization. Ukushisa okusheshayo kunganciphisa isikhathi ukuze kufinyelelwe izinga lokushisa lokucima, kodwa isikhathi sokubamba kumele siqinisekise ukuthi i-austenite ihlanganiswe ngokuphelele.
4. Ukushisa kokucima kanye nesikhathi sezinto ezivamile ze-roller chain
Uchungechunge lwe-roller yensimbi yekhabhoni
Insimbi engu-45: Izinga lokushisa lokucima ngokuvamile lingu-800℃-850℃, futhi isikhathi sokubamba sinqunywa ngokosayizi weketanga le-roller kanye nomthwalo wesithando, ngokuvamile cishe imizuzu engama-30-60. Isibonelo, kumaketanga amancane e-roller ensimbi angu-45, izinga lokushisa lokucima lingakhethwa njengo-820℃, kanti isikhathi sokuvala singamaminithi angama-30; kumaketanga amakhulu e-roller, izinga lokushisa lokuvala lingakhushulwa libe ngu-840℃, kanti isikhathi sokuvala singamaminithi angama-60.
Insimbi ye-T8: Izinga lokushisa lokucima licishe libe ngu-780℃-820℃, futhi isikhathi sokushisa ngokuvamile siyimizuzu engama-20-50. Iketanga le-roller lensimbi ye-T8 linobunzima obukhulu ngemva kokucima futhi lingasetshenziswa ngezikhathi zokudlulisela ngemithwalo emikhulu yokushaya.
Uchungechunge lwe-roller yensimbi ye-alloy
Insimbi engu-20CrMnTi: Izinga lokushisa lokucima livame ukuba ngu-860℃-900℃, kanti isikhathi sokushisa siyimizuzu engu-40-70min. Le nto inokuqina okuhle kanye nokumelana nokuguguleka, futhi isetshenziswa kabanzi kumaketanga okugoqa ezimbonini zezimoto, izithuthuthu kanye neminye imboni.
Insimbi engu-40Cr: Izinga lokushisa lokucima lingu-830℃-860℃, kanti isikhathi sokushisa siyimizuzu engama-30-60min. Iketanga le-roller lensimbi elingu-40Cr linamandla aphezulu nokuqina, futhi lisetshenziswa kabanzi emkhakheni wokudlulisa izimboni.
Iketanga lokugoqa lensimbi engagqwali: Uma sibheka insimbi engagqwali engu-304 njengesibonelo, izinga lokushisa lalo lokucima ngokuvamile lingu-1050℃-1150℃, kanti isikhathi sokushisa siyimizuzu engama-30-60. Iketanga lokugoqa lensimbi engagqwali linokumelana okuhle nokugqwala futhi lifanelekela izimboni zamakhemikhali, ukudla kanye nezinye izimboni.
5. Ukulawula inqubo yokucima
Ukulawula inqubo yokushisa: Sebenzisa imishini yokushisa ethuthukisiwe, njengesithando somoya esilawulwayo, ukulawula ngokunembile izinga lokushisa kanye nomoya esithandweni somlilo ukuze unciphise ukushiswa kwegesi kanye nokususwa kwe-carburization. Ngesikhathi senqubo yokushisa, lawula izinga lokushisa ngezigaba ukuze ugweme ukuguquka kwe-roller chain noma ukucindezeleka kokushisa okubangelwa ukwenyuka kwezinga lokushisa okungazelelwe.
Ukukhethwa kwe-quenching medium kanye nokulawula inqubo yokupholisa: Khetha i-quenching medium efanelekile ngokwezinto zokwakha kanye nosayizi we-roller chain, njengamanzi, uwoyela, uketshezi lokucima i-polymer, njll. Amanzi anejubane lokupholisa elisheshayo futhi afaneleka kumaketanga e-roller ensimbi yekhabhoni amancane; uwoyela unejubane lokupholisa elihamba kancane futhi afaneleka kumaketanga e-roller ensimbi amakhulu noma ahlanganisiwe. Ngesikhathi senqubo yokupholisa, lawula izinga lokushisa, ijubane lokuvuselela kanye neminye imingcele ye-quenching medium ukuqinisekisa ukupholisa okufanayo futhi ugweme ukucima imifantu.
Ukwelashwa kokushisa: Iketanga le-roller ngemva kokushisa kufanele lifudumale ngesikhathi ukuze kuqedwe ukucindezeleka kokushisa, kuqiniswe isakhiwo futhi kuthuthukiswe ukuqina. Izinga lokushisa lokushisa ngokuvamile lingu-150℃-300℃, kanti isikhathi sokubamba singu-1h-3h. Ukukhethwa kwezinga lokushisa lokushisa kufanele kunqunywe ngokwezidingo zokusetshenziswa kanye nezidingo zokuqina kweketanga le-roller. Isibonelo, kumaketanga e-roller adinga ubulukhuni obuphezulu, izinga lokushisa lokushisa lingancishiswa ngokufanele.
6. Intuthuko yakamuva yobuchwepheshe bokucima
Inqubo yokucima i-isothermal: Ngokulawula izinga lokushisa le-quenching medium, i-roller chain igcinwa isothermally ebangeni lokushisa lokuguqulwa kwe-austenite kanye ne-bainite ukuze kutholakale isakhiwo se-bainite. Ukucima i-isothermal kunganciphisa ukuguquguquka kokucima, kuthuthukise ukunemba okulinganiselwe kanye nezakhiwo zemishini ze-roller chain, futhi kufanelekile ekukhiqizweni kwamaketanga e-roller anokunemba okuphezulu. Isibonelo, amapharamitha enqubo yokucima i-isothermal yepuleti lensimbi le-C55E angokushisa kokucima okungu-850℃, izinga lokushisa le-isothermal elingu-310℃, isikhathi se-isothermal esingu-25min. Ngemva kokucima, ubulukhuni bepuleti le-chain buhlangabezana nezidingo zobuchwepheshe, futhi amandla, ukukhathala nezinye izakhiwo ze-chain ziseduze nalezo zezinto ze-50CrV eziphathwe ngenqubo efanayo.
Inqubo yokucima okulinganiselwe: Iketanga le-roller liqala lipholiswe endaweni esezingeni lokushisa eliphezulu, bese lipholiswa endaweni esezingeni lokushisa eliphansi, ukuze izakhiwo zangaphakathi nezangaphandle zeketanga le-roller ziguqulwe ngokulinganayo. Ukucima kancane kancane kunganciphisa ngempumelelo ukucindezeleka kokucima, kunciphise amaphutha okucima, futhi kuthuthukise ikhwalithi kanye nokusebenza kweketanga le-roller.
Ubuchwepheshe bokulingisa ikhompyutha nokwenza ngcono: Sebenzisa isofthiwe yokulingisa ikhompyutha, njenge-JMatPro, ukuze ulingise inqubo yokucima uchungechunge lwe-roller, ubikezele izinguquko ekuhleleni nasekusebenzeni, futhi ulungise amapharamitha enqubo yokucima. Ngokusebenzisa ukulingisa, ithonya lamazinga okushisa ahlukene okucima kanye nezikhathi ekusebenzeni kochungechunge lwe-roller lingaqondwa kusengaphambili, inani lokuhlolwa lingancishiswa, futhi ukusebenza kahle komklamo wenqubo kungathuthukiswa.
